Output 5dc318ab249b325f05c3332984eca4453d08dc8336525dfd85382bcff37666d5:3

value
34372628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b604207b708c57ab9e496e75f415f55a35f77c98 OP_EQUAL
address
MQVaA5qZv1XWRAovvs4pkW25S9NkcA8KHz
transaction
5dc318ab249b325f05c3332984eca4453d08dc8336525dfd85382bcff37666d5
spent
true